Photo of the Day (1/17/08)


Appropriately titled "Smiley," this wonderful shot by Fiznatty perfectly captures that spontaneous grin that occasionally greets travelers in remote lands where simply catching sight of a foreigner is enough to trigger a child's irrepressible smile.

What makes this shot even more amazing is that it was taken in northern Rwanda--a place more commonly associated with horror than with our smiley friend above. It's certainly a testament that no matter how bad a place might be, a child's resiliency will always shine through.
